Dual-fiber patch cords contain two optical fibers within a single cable jacket, enabling simultaneous transmit and receive signals for full-duplex communication. They are commonly used in high-speed networks, data centers, and telecom applications where bidirectional data transfer is required .
Dual-fiber patch cords can be single-mode (OS1/OS2) for long-distance transmission or multimode (OM1/OM2/OM3/OM4/OM5) for short-distance, high-bandwidth intra-data center links . The choice of fiber type affects distance, bandwidth, and compatibility with transceivers.
Dual-fiber patch cords are essential for full-duplex optical links, connecting switches, servers, patch panels, and transceivers. They are widely used in data centers, LANs, and telecom networks where high-speed, low-loss connections are critical . In summary, dual-fiber patch cords use paired connectors like LC-LC, SC-SC, or MTP/MPO, support both single-mode and multimode fibers, and are designed for full-duplex communication in high-performance optical networks.
